Magnesium in PDB 4rvy: Serial Time Resolved Crystallography of Photosystem II Using A Femtosecond X-Ray Laser. the S State After Two Flashes (S3)

Enzymatic activity of Serial Time Resolved Crystallography of Photosystem II Using A Femtosecond X-Ray Laser. the S State After Two Flashes (S3)

All present enzymatic activity of Serial Time Resolved Crystallography of Photosystem II Using A Femtosecond X-Ray Laser. the S State After Two Flashes (S3):
1.10.3.9;

Protein crystallography data

The structure of Serial Time Resolved Crystallography of Photosystem II Using A Femtosecond X-Ray Laser. the S State After Two Flashes (S3), PDB code: 4rvy was solved by C.Kupitz, S.Basu, I.Grotjohann, R.Fromme, N.Zatsepin, K.N.Rendek, M.Hunter, R.L.Shoeman, T.A.White, D.Wang, D.James, J.-H.Yang, D.E.Cobb, B.Reeder, R.G.Sierra, H.Liu, A.Barty, A.Aquila, D.Deponte, R.Kirian, S.Bari, J.J.Bergkamp, K.Beyerlein, M.J.Bogan, C.Caleman, T.-C.Chao, C.E.Conrad, K.M.Davis, H.Fleckenstein, L.Galli, S.P.Hau-Riege, S.Kassemeyer, H.Laksmono, M.Liang, L.Lomb, S.Marchesini, A.V.Martin, M.Messerschmidt, D.Milathianaki, K.Nass, A.Ros, S.Roy-Chowdhury, K.Schmidt, M.Seibert, J.Steinbrener, F.Stellato, L.Yan, C.Yoon, T.A.Moore, A.L.Moore, Y.Pushkar, G.J.Williams, S.Boutet, R.B.Doak, U.Weierstall, M.Frank, H.N.Chapman, J.C.H.Spence, P.Fromme,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 102.30 / 5.50
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 136.610, 228.090, 308.680, 90.00, 90.00, 90.00
R / Rfree (%) 28.1 / 29.1

Other elements in 4rvy:

The structure of Serial Time Resolved Crystallography of Photosystem II Using A Femtosecond X-Ray Laser. the S State After Two Flashes (S3) also contains other interesting chemical elements:

Manganese (Mn) 8 atoms
Iron (Fe) 6 atoms
Calcium (Ca) 8 atoms
Chlorine (Cl) 6 atoms
